Energy Trader salary in Vietnam

Average Yearly Salary of Energy Trader in Vietnam is approximately 210,705,087 VND (8,311 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Energy Trader do?

occupation personasAn energy trader is a professional who specializes in buying and selling energy commodities such as oil, gas, electricity, and renewable energy credits. They work for energy companies, investment banks, hedge funds, or trading firms. The primary role of an energy trader is to analyze market trends, supply and demand dynamics, and geopolitical factors to make informed decisions about when and how to buy or sell energy products. They monitor market prices, execute trades, manage risk exposure, and maximize profits for their employers or clients.
